汪平陽
【摘 要】本文通過對兩起典型案例的分析解決,初步探討了當前的核心異構網(wǎng)絡下DTMF的傳遞方式。本文研究了在PCM和IP兩種傳輸方式對接的情況下,帶內、外信號的協(xié)商方式,完成了不同場景下的呼叫測試驗證,并初步探討了不同類型的核心網(wǎng)對接對DTMF信號傳送的影響。
【關鍵詞】DTMF;帶外協(xié)商;PCM;核心異構網(wǎng)絡
中圖分類號: TN929.5 文獻標識碼: A 文章編號: 2095-2457(2018)14-0042-003
DOI:10.19694/j.cnki.issn2095-2457.2018.14.018
Preliminary discussion on the transmission mechanism of DTMF signal in heterogeneous network
WANG Ping-yang
(China Unicom Hefei Branch Operation and Maintenance Department, Hefei Anhui 230000, China)
【Abstract】Through two typical cases analysis, the transfer mode of DTMF in core heterogeneous network is discussed in this paper. In this paper, the negotiation mode of in-band and out-band signals is studied when PCM and IP are connected, and the call test verification in different situations is completed.And the effect of different types of core network docking on DTMF signal transmission is preliminarily discussed.
【Key words】DTMF; Out-of-band consultation; PCM; Core heterogeneous network
1 案例一.某銀行客服電話外呼寧波移動手機號碼驗證密碼不通過問題處理
1.1 描述與分析
某銀行信用卡客戶服務中心通過與某地運營商軟交換關口局對接,發(fā)起外呼業(yè)務。目前接到用戶反應問題如下:
該銀行信用卡客戶服務中心4006XXXXXX回訪寧波辦理信用卡的移動手機用戶139XXXX1490,在通話過程中需要輸入驗證密碼,用戶輸入密碼后,提示密碼驗證錯誤。根據(jù)現(xiàn)象分析應該是用戶發(fā)送的密碼與中國銀行客服系統(tǒng)存儲的密碼不一致所致,分析整個呼叫路由:某銀行客戶平臺—某地運營商綜合關口局-某地運營商上級TSS-浙江TSS-寧波綜合關口局-寧波移動公司。分別在通話發(fā)起端和落地端進行信令跟蹤已經(jīng)與廠家溝通后,最終確定了原因和處理辦法。
1.2 處理過程
(1)首先,通過聯(lián)系某銀行客戶服務中心,撥打139XXXX1490用戶,當日上午第一次撥打用戶驗密成功,當日下午第二次測試沒有成功。通過使用Beyond Compare軟件對兩次信令采集的ANM消息和CONNECT消息進行比較,截圖如下:
如圖1所示,通過對兩次呼叫的相關信令消息和整個呼叫信令的分析,基本可以判斷某地運營商綜合關口局未對相關信令進行調整和修改,綜合關口局只對相關信令進行了透傳。
(2)由于關口局未查到相關差異,通過聯(lián)系浙江寧波分公司尋求幫助,寧波分公司對呼叫信令進行了研究并確認了問題所在:139XXXX1490為寧波移動Volte用戶,由于寧波移動的IM-MGW開通了Trfo,IM-MGW開啟DTMF檢號,所以用戶在登陸在4G網(wǎng)絡上,就會發(fā)生對用戶在通話過程中通過DTMF發(fā)送的驗證密碼進行了再次提取,這樣帶外信令會有一份,帶內信令沒有刪除,導致平臺收到重復的DTMF,也就是收到了重復密碼。從而造成驗密失敗。
1.3 處理結果和結論
第一次驗密正常是因為該手機號碼139XXXX1490登陸寧波移動3G網(wǎng)絡上,根據(jù)寧波分公司反饋,2、3G網(wǎng)絡不存在上述問題。第二次驗密不正常是用戶登陸在移動4G網(wǎng)絡上,移動的IM-MGW開啟DTMF檢號的造成。目前這個問題還不能夠解決,待對端IMS網(wǎng)絡版本升級后才能解決。所以建議再遇到此類問題,讓用戶選擇2、3G網(wǎng)絡進行撥打操作。這里簡單解釋下帶內信令和帶外信令的含義:所謂帶內信令指的是信號的頻率在話音頻率范圍之內(0.3~3.4kHz)隨語音通路一起傳送,相對于帶外信令(共路信令)例如:NO.7信令,是獨立的信令網(wǎng)。其中NO.1號信令,DTMF信號就屬于帶內信號。
2 案例二. 某銀行客服撥打云南移動手機號碼驗證密碼不通過分析問題處理
2.1 研究背景
近日,接到某銀行大客戶投訴反映:其公司信用卡外呼中心號碼4006XXXXXX外呼云南移動用戶無法驗密通過。
2.2 處理過程
某銀行外呼中心平臺從某地運營商關口局接入,其關口局通過信令跟蹤判斷某地運營商發(fā)起端信令已正常送出,隨后我方牽頭聯(lián)系云南T局和關口局方面進行聯(lián)合信令跟蹤,并將追蹤到的消息與正常消息比對,均無異常。由此判斷安徽和云南聯(lián)通方的BICC和ISUP信令傳送沒有問題。問題出現(xiàn)在被叫云南移動方的可能性較大。
2.2.1 某銀行外呼系統(tǒng)業(yè)務流程
當某銀行信用卡用戶辦理信用卡后,會與移動卡進行捆綁使用,當中行外呼該用戶后,客戶終端會根據(jù)語音提示輸入信用卡密碼,密碼以語音呼叫形式在網(wǎng)絡傳送,這種消息為DTMF消息。例如手機撥打10010、12580、116114等平臺時也是通過NTMR消息將用戶按下的鍵傳送到相關平臺,但送去這些業(yè)務平臺的DTMF消息是能夠通過移動網(wǎng)絡正常傳送的。
2.2.2 網(wǎng)絡拓撲圖
DTMF帶外傳送網(wǎng)絡拓樸圖見圖3。
2.2.3 可能故障點
DTMF消息在IP化改造后的局間傳送采用帶外的方式,而在A接口、IuB口、合肥聯(lián)通軟交換關口局到中行服務器端都是TDM傳輸,DTMF傳送采用帶內的方式。通過信令追蹤,發(fā)現(xiàn)帶外信令中的部分DTMF消息網(wǎng)元側無法抓取,而云南移動方從端局抓取客戶提供的設備發(fā)送的DTMF消息則可以正常解析。初步判斷可能的故障原因是:
一是某些DTMF消息由帶內向帶外轉換時出錯或者帶外轉帶內時出錯,而相關故障點可能是移動軟交換端局(帶內轉帶外)或中興軟交換關口局(帶外轉帶內)。
二是客戶端原因,如用戶輸入的密碼和中行密碼認證系統(tǒng)中存儲的密碼不一致,或是客戶在數(shù)據(jù)密碼是開啟免提功能,雜音干擾了DTMF信號的傳遞,造成誤差。
三是如果DTMF信號從云南移動客戶端到某地運營商關口局這一段路由的傳遞完成正常,即運營商的網(wǎng)絡沒有任何問題,則只可能是某地銀行服務器到其北京總部的認證系統(tǒng)這一段存在問題(由于某地運營商網(wǎng)絡到北京之間存在IP包的多重轉發(fā),以及明密文的轉換等因素)
四是如果因云南移動用戶登錄在VOLTE網(wǎng)絡上發(fā)起DTMF信號傳遞,可能存在DTMF信號帶內帶外雙重傳遞,而造成誤差的情況。
2.2.4 排除分析
首先,云南移動省分工程師在曲靖/昆明/文山(某銀行反映有問題的地區(qū))三地的端局進行信令抓包。通過測試發(fā)現(xiàn),所有昆明移動用戶的驗密均可通過,且登錄在2/3/4G及VOLTE網(wǎng)絡上均得到驗證,由此可排除上述第四點故障原因。
隨后,該銀行提供了幾例問題客戶端用戶,并進行撥測,云南移動工程師同步跟蹤,測試結果是部分被叫用戶聲稱密碼錯誤,部分正常。此時云南移動工程師提出:希望驗證問題用戶發(fā)出的DTMF信號(移動端局抓?。┖湍炽y行北京總部收到的DTMF信號是否一致,但由于涉及用戶隱私,該驗證方法不可取。
與此同時,云南移動方面同時對本局設置的DTMF按鍵之間的間隔時長,號碼的電平、高低頻的要求和規(guī)范進行了對比,認為他們的DTMF設置完全符合規(guī)范,不存在問題。
為了盡快查找到問題,經(jīng)過和云南移動的多次協(xié)調,曲靖和文山的移動維護人員自愿使用自己的中行信用卡配合測試(不再涉及用戶隱私),同時我方也通過電話會議的方式同時聯(lián)系中行總部的技術人員和云南移動方,經(jīng)過三方討論,達成測試方案:一是必須多次多網(wǎng)絡測試,每個號碼至少撥打10次,并請用戶登錄在2/3/4G網(wǎng)絡下分別嘗試;二是某銀行總部技術人員在認證平臺側同時配合跟蹤。
經(jīng)過測試,發(fā)現(xiàn)文山的用戶驗密同樣每次都可以通過,而曲靖用戶驗密問題10次有5次提示密碼錯誤,從移動方抓取到7次錄音記錄分析,驗密失敗的通話部分原因是被叫方開了免提,部分原因不明。
以上結果驗證了兩點:一 至少存在部分被叫用戶的DTMF驗證問題,某銀行反映的問題基本屬實;二 由于是移動員工持本人信用卡進行測試,其密碼輸入準確無誤,基本也排除了普通用戶誤操作的可能,即排除了第二種故障原因。
至此,經(jīng)過再次推動和協(xié)調,某銀行總部提供了驗密系統(tǒng)收到密碼數(shù)字,云南移動將端局DTMF信號和總部驗密系統(tǒng)收到的DTMF信號進行了對比,結果為6位數(shù)字完全一致,第一種故障原因也排除了,即運營商網(wǎng)絡的DTMF傳遞沒有任何問題!
據(jù)此,我方定位問題出在某銀行總部驗密系統(tǒng),并要求該銀行自查并撤銷投訴。
3 本文小結
本文通過成功解決兩宗用戶投訴.初步分析了現(xiàn)在不同網(wǎng)絡、不同廠家、不同運營商之間DTMF的傳遞方式。通過對PCM和IP兩種傳輸方式對接的帶內、外協(xié)商,以及不同場景下的呼叫測試驗證,初步探討了不同類型的核心網(wǎng),不同的參數(shù)設置對接口間協(xié)商機制和DTMF信號傳送的影響。文中涉及的設備為華為和中興,希望本文的一些方法及經(jīng)驗可以提供借鑒,文中如有考慮不周之處也希望各位專家批評指正。
【參考文獻】
[1]軟交換BICC信令規(guī)范.
[2]中興設備操作幫助手冊.